The Nipissing University Muskoka Campus is pleased to announce the presentation of The Rez Sisters by Canadian playwright Tomson Highway.
This “gutsy, gritty, funny, risk-taking piece of work…” (SICC review) will be presented by the Muskoka Campus Theatre Production class on Wednesday, March 26, 8 p.m. at Rene M. Caisse Memorial Theatre in Bracebridge.
Under the direction of professor Robin Clipsham, Highway’s award-winning play chronicles the lives of seven native women from the Wasaychigan Hill Reserve on Manitoulin Island. When the women’s adventures take them off the reservation to The Biggest Bingo In The World, their bond of sisterhood is tested and renewed. The many layers of the play show how the spirit world interacts with the real world in funny and poignant ways.
